Emergency Response to Supermarket Car Park Incident

Emergency services were called to a supermarket car park on Soho Road in Handsworth at approximately 12.45pm on Monday, February 2nd. Upon arrival, paramedics and police officers discovered a man in cardiac arrest with serious injuries.

The 40-year-old victim was immediately transported to hospital for urgent medical treatment. Despite the best efforts of medical staff, he sadly passed away on Wednesday afternoon, February 4th. Specialist detectives have informed his family and are providing them with support during this distressing time.

Police Investigation and Arrests

Detectives have established that the victim was involved in a disorder that broke out in the Soho Road and Holyhead Road area prior to being found injured. As part of their ongoing investigation, police have made two arrests in connection with the incident.

A 34-year-old man was arrested on Tuesday, February 3rd, on suspicion of attempted murder and has been released on bail pending further enquiries. A second 34-year-old man was arrested on suspicion of assault and has been released under investigation while police continue their work.
